Phillip James Kimball “Jim,” 85, of Woodruff, passed away peacefully and went to his Lord and Savior on May 7, 2023, after a short illness. He was born in Ironwood, Mich. on November 20, 1937, to Robert and Adele (Ringwall) Kimball. He attended school in Ironwood, graduating from Saint Ambrose High School in 1955. Upon graduation, Jim served his country in the U.S. Army and was stationed in Germany.
He owned Lakeland Construction and was well known in the surrounding area for his lifelong expertise in building and carpentry skills. He had a love of the outdoors, enjoying fishing, canoeing, healthy living and exercise. Every year, he grew an amazing vegetable garden, which transferred to his kitchen for his culinary talents.
Jim was a longtime member and deacon of Lakeland Seventh-Day Adventist Church and lived his life serving and guiding others in the way of Christ. He also enjoyed cooking for the Saturday church service potluck dinners. Jim will be loved and missed by all who knew him.
He is survived by his sisters, Kathleen (Joseph) Markiewicz, Donna (Lewey) Beckham and his brothers, Dennis and Brian Kimball. He was preceded in death by his beloved parents and his brother Michael (Robin) Kimball.
A memorial service will be held this summer at Lakeland Seventh-Day Adventist Church. Bolger Funeral Home is assisting the family, www.bolgerfuneral.com for condolences.
